Solid-State Power Management — No Relays, No Fuses
- No relays — eliminates relay failure, relay noise, and relay heat load
- No fuses — solid-state overcurrent protection replaces traditional fuse-based protection
- Reduced heat load — runs cooler than relay-based systems under sustained high-draw operation
- Consistent output — stable power delivery for light bars, whips, fans, pumps, and electronics under harsh conditions
Programmable Circuit Behavior
- Standard on/off — latching control
- Momentary — circuit active only while switch is held
- Strobe — programmable strobe pattern for warning lights and whips
- Dimming — variable output for dimmable lighting accessories

Installation Notes
- Professional installation required. Center console electrical integration requires a qualified technician.
- Confirm Maverick R model and trim. All 2024–2026 Maverick R variants listed above are confirmed fitment. Verify your specific trim before ordering.
- Verify accessory load. Do not exceed 30 amps per circuit. Calculate total draw before wiring.
- Confirm console clearance. Verify center console mounting clearance and accessory cable routing before installation.
